A Pulumi provider for managing Better Uptime monitoring, alerting, and incident management resources, dynamically bridged from the Terraform Better Uptime provider with support for monitors, heartbeats, integrations, status pages, and policies.

import * as pulumi from "@pulumi/pulumi"; export declare class Heartbeat extends pulumi.CustomResource { /** * Get an existing Heartbeat resource's state with the given name, ID, and optional extra * properties used to qualify the lookup. * * @param name The _unique_ name of the resulting resource. * @param id The _unique_ provider ID of the resource to lookup. * @param state Any extra arguments used during the lookup. * @param opts Optional settings to control the behavior of the CustomResource. */ static get(name: string, id: pulumi.Input<pulumi.ID>, state?: HeartbeatState, opts?: pulumi.CustomResourceOptions): Heartbeat; /** * Returns true if the given object is an instance of Heartbeat. This is designed to work even * when multiple copies of the Pulumi SDK have been loaded into the same process. */ static isInstance(obj: any): obj is Heartbeat; /** * Whether to call when a new incident is created. */ readonly call: pulumi.Output<boolean>; /** * The time when this heartbeat was created. */ readonly createdAt: pulumi.Output<string>; /** * Whether to send a critical push notification that ignores the mute switch and Do not Disturb mode when a new incident is * created. */ readonly criticalAlert: pulumi.Output<boolean>; /** * Whether to send an email when a new incident is created. */ readonly email: pulumi.Output<boolean>; /** * Heartbeats can fluctuate; specify this value to control what is still acceptable. Minimum value: 0 seconds. We recommend * setting this to approx. 20% of period */ readonly grace: pulumi.Output<number>; /** * Set this attribute if you want to add this heartbeat to a heartbeat group.. */ readonly heartbeatGroupId: pulumi.Output<number>; /** * An array of maintenance days to set. If a maintenance window is overnight both affected days should be set. Allowed * values are ["mon", "tue", "wed", "thu", "fri", "sat", "sun"] or any subset of these days. */ readonly maintenanceDays: pulumi.Output<string[]>; /** * Start of the maintenance window each day. We won't create incidents during this window. Example: "01:00:00" */ readonly maintenanceFrom: pulumi.Output<string>; /** * The timezone to use for the maintenance window each day. Defaults to UTC. The accepted values can be found in the Rails * TimeZone documentation. https://api.rubyonrails.org/classes/ActiveSupport/TimeZone.html */ readonly maintenanceTimezone: pulumi.Output<string>; /** * End of the maintenance window each day. Example: "03:00:00" */ readonly maintenanceTo: pulumi.Output<string>; /** * A name of the service for this heartbeat. */ readonly name: pulumi.Output<string>; /** * Set to true to pause monitoring — we won't notify you about downtime. Set to false to resume monitoring. */ readonly paused: pulumi.Output<boolean>; /** * The time when this heartbeat was paused. */ readonly pausedAt: pulumi.Output<string>; /** * How often should we expect this heartbeat? In seconds. Minimum value: 30 seconds */ readonly period: pulumi.Output<number>; /** * Set the escalation policy for the heartbeat. */ readonly policyId: pulumi.Output<string | undefined>; /** * Whether to send a push notification when a new incident is created. */ readonly push: pulumi.Output<boolean>; /** * Whether to send an SMS when a new incident is created. */ readonly sms: pulumi.Output<boolean>; /** * An index controlling the position of a heartbeat in the heartbeat group. */ readonly sortIndex: pulumi.Output<number>; /** * The status of this heartbeat. */ readonly status: pulumi.Output<string>; /** * Used to specify the team the resource should be created in when using global tokens. */ readonly teamName: pulumi.Output<string | undefined>; /** * How long to wait before escalating the incident alert to the team. Leave blank to disable escalating to the entire team. */ readonly teamWait: pulumi.Output<number>; /** * The time when this heartbeat was updated. */ readonly updatedAt: pulumi.Output<string>; /** * The url of this heartbeat. */ readonly url: pulumi.Output<string>; /** * Create a Heartbeat resource with the given unique name, arguments, and options. * * @param name The _unique_ name of the resource. * @param args The arguments to use to populate this resource's properties. * @param opts A bag of options that control this resource's behavior. */ constructor(name: string, args: HeartbeatArgs, opts?: pulumi.CustomResourceOptions); } /** * Input properties used for looking up and filtering Heartbeat resources. */ export interface HeartbeatState { /** * Whether to call when a new incident is created. */ call?: pulumi.Input<boolean>; /** * The time when this heartbeat was created. */ createdAt?: pulumi.Input<string>; /** * Whether to send a critical push notification that ignores the mute switch and Do not Disturb mode when a new incident is * created. */ criticalAlert?: pulumi.Input<boolean>; /** * Whether to send an email when a new incident is created. */ email?: pulumi.Input<boolean>; /** * Heartbeats can fluctuate; specify this value to control what is still acceptable.
